技术文摘
Python Matplotlib:如何打造令人惊叹的数据可视化,你可知晓?
Python Matplotlib:如何打造令人惊叹的数据可视化,你可知晓?
在当今数据驱动的世界中,有效地展示数据对于理解和传达信息至关重要。Python 的 Matplotlib 库为我们提供了强大的工具,能够将复杂的数据转化为令人惊叹的可视化图表。
Matplotlib 拥有丰富的绘图功能,涵盖了从简单的折线图、柱状图到复杂的三维图形等各种类型。通过几行简单的代码,我们就可以创建出直观且具有吸引力的图表。
安装 Matplotlib 库非常简便。使用 pip 命令即可轻松完成安装。在开始绘图之前,我们需要导入所需的模块,然后准备好要绘制的数据。
例如,绘制一个简单的折线图来展示一段时间内的销售数据。我们可以定义 x 轴表示时间,y 轴表示销售额。通过设置线条的颜色、标记和样式,使图表更具可读性和美观性。
对于多组数据的比较,柱状图是一个不错的选择。我们可以清晰地看到不同类别之间的差异和趋势。在绘制柱状图时,可以调整柱子的宽度、颜色和间距,以突出重点和增强视觉效果。
除了基本的图表类型,Matplotlib 还支持绘制散点图、饼图、箱线图等。散点图有助于发现数据之间的关系和趋势;饼图则适合展示数据的占比情况;箱线图能够直观地反映数据的分布特征。
为了让图表更加专业和吸引人,我们还可以添加标题、坐标轴标签、图例等元素。并且,通过调整字体大小、颜色和样式,使整个图表看起来更加协调。
另外,Matplotlib 允许我们对图表进行个性化的定制。比如,设置背景颜色、网格线的显示与否、刻度线的样式等。甚至可以将多个子图组合在一个大图中,同时展示多个相关的数据集。
掌握 Python 的 Matplotlib 库,能够让我们在数据可视化的道路上如鱼得水。通过巧妙地运用各种绘图功能和定制选项,我们可以打造出令人惊叹的数据可视化作品,更有效地传达数据背后的故事和信息。无论是在数据分析、科研报告还是商业展示中,Matplotlib 都能发挥出巨大的作用,帮助我们从数据中挖掘出有价值的见解。
TAGS: Python 数据可视化 Python matplotlib 令人惊叹的数据可视化 Matplotlib 技巧
- Python 中删除文件的多种方法,你了解吗?
- Python 动态进度条的实现方式
- Upload-Lab 第一关:前端验证轻松绕过技巧!
- Acks=all 消息竟也会丢失?
- C/C++ 中 const 关键字的多样玩法:位置决定含义
- 十个鲜为人知且少用的 HTML 标签
- 选择 Zephir 为 PHP 编写动态扩展库的原因
- 老板让我实现碎片化效果的鸟,能难住我?
- Python 性能优化的十大技巧
- 前端学习难度增大的原因:JavaScript 框架发展简史探讨
- 面试官提问:如何设计分布式任务调度平台?
- 如何解决 Spring Jpa 的问题
- 深度解析 SpringBoot 启动原理:一张长图带你读懂
- Java 应用程序内存使用的测试与优化,你掌握了吗?
- Go1.23 新特性:Slices、Panic、Cookie 等函数优化,效率大幅提升!